Make sure you have a fee schedule for any lawyers you are thinking about retaining. The charges widely vary from lawyer to lawyer, so you need to know what is in store. You don't want to have to dismiss an attorney late in the game because you simply can't afford them.

Try to avoid a lawyer that does not have a specific area of law they specialize in. There are lawyers all over that specialize in different fields of study. Hiring one of them will increase your chances of success since the person you hire will know exactly what they are doing once they step into the courtroom.

Try to educate yourself on what you are dealing with. You should not be relying solely on the lawyer to plan and construct your case. Obviously, they will have more knowledge and experience dealing with your situation, but if you are prepared, you can work together as a team to get the win.

Heed your lawyer's advice, but remember that he or she is your employee. Do not be scared to say something if you're unhappy with things they say. This way, your lawyer will know exactly what you desire.

Ask your lawyer questions. A good lawyer will explain in detail what he or she is doing and keep you updated. If you feel, at any time, that your lawyer is unable to respond to your questions as he should, you should discuss this with him, and if need be, find someone who will.

See if the people that work in the office of your lawyer are nice people. Anytime you call the office, write down the amount of time it takes for you to return it. In addition, note the receptionist's tone of voice. If your messages are taking a long time to get returned, or the receptionist sounds unfriendly, then this can be a sign as to your treatment when you become a client.

When looking for a lawyer, time is significant. However, it is not so important that you hire the first lawyer you meet. Always consider more than one lawyer. You need to make sure they have the skills you need, that you can afford them, and they will fight for your best interests.

Before you have a lawyer working for you, have a fee agreement in writing and signed. This way, you won't end up paying more than you've agreed to pay. You will also be able to get the money you need together.

Settle on the amount of time and money you wish to invest in procuring a lawyer. Also, take the money you will lose from taking off work into consideration. You must think about all costs when considering adding a lawyer to your budget. Be careful not to spend more than you need to on a lawyer.

When you are trying to hire a lawyer for your case, do not hesitate to ask them for some references. You should talk with two or three people that can give you a good idea of what to expect. You should hire someone else if they give you a hard time about providing references.

Contact your local bar association if you need a lawyer. Bar associations provide the public with referrals for different kinds of lawyer and also receive complaints. If you need to do some background research on a lawyer, contact your local bar association to find out if anyone has filed a complaint against this lawyer.
